Korea’s tragic history is closely connected to global history. The country’s significant events are not isolated but occurred within the larger context of political, economic, and military shifts in East Asia and the world. This connection provides valuable insights into Korea’s place within the broader currents of global history.

The Imjin War is remembered as a significant historical event in East Asia, marking a moment of resilience for Korea and the importance of maritime defense strategies.

The Byeongja Horan is remembered as a traumatic event in Korean history, symbolizing the vulnerability of the Joseon Dynasty during a period of political and military weakness.

The Byeongin Yangyo illustrates the tension between Korea's traditional isolationism and the growing pressures of Western imperialism during the 19th century.

Understanding history is essential for several reasons, as it provides us with context, lessons, and tools to navigate the present and shape the future. Here’s why studying history is important. History helps explain how the world got to where it is today. From social structures to political systems, cultural norms, and international relationships, understanding their origins provides clarity about why things are the way they are. By studying history, we can learn from past successes and failures. This can help us avoid repeating mistakes and replicate strategies that worked well in solving problems. History connects us to our roots, helping us understand our cultural heritage, values, and traditions. It fosters a sense of identity and pride while also promoting empathy for others' experiences and histories. Exploring history sharpens analytical and critical thinking skills. It challenges us to evaluate sources, question perspectives, and understand the complexity of human decisions and events. Historical movements, revolutions, and innovations inspire us to drive change. By examining how individuals or groups achieved progress, we can apply those lessons to modern challenges. Understanding the struggles, triumphs, and everyday lives of people in the past fosters empathy and a broader perspective on human nature. History teaches us about different cultures, civilizations, and global interactions. This helps build mutual respect and cooperation in an interconnected world. History provides patterns and trends that can guide decision-making in politics, economics, and societal development. It helps us anticipate and prepare for potential challenges by understanding past cycles. Studying history equips individuals with the knowledge to engage meaningfully in civic life. Understanding historical contexts behind laws, rights, and conflicts allows people to participate thoughtfully in democracy. In essence, history is not just about the past; it’s a tool to better understand ourselves, our society, and our potential for growth.
